Scope and Contents

Olivia Manning papers consist of correspondence (handwritten and typed letters and cards from Olivia Manning to Kay Dick (aka Edward Lane) and Kathleen Farrell and one black and white photograph featuring Olivia Manning and Kay Dick at a Heinemann’s garden party, circa 1940s and writinigs (drafts, galley proofs, excised material, and book jacket blurbs).
